Professional baseball player Hanshin Tigers announced that it has won a total of 95 wins in Japan and the United States, pitcher Chen Wei-Yin, who has signed a free contract with Lotte.

Left-handed pitcher Chen is 35 years old from Taiwan.



He played in Chunichi for eight years and won 36 wins, including winning the title with the highest ERA.



After that, he transferred to the major leagues and won 59 wins in the major leagues, including three double-digit wins in the Orioles, marking a total of 95 wins in Japan and the United States.



This season, he joined Lotte in September after signing a free contract with the Mariners minor team, and started in four games with 0 wins and 3 losses and an ERA of 2.42.



Pitcher Chen had a free contract with Lotte on the 2nd of this month, but he has reached a basic agreement with Hanshin, who had been trying to reinforce the starting pitcher on the left.



The contract period is expected to be two years, the annual salary is estimated to be about 207 million yen, and the uniform number is set to "14".



Through the team, Chen said, "One reason I decided to join the Hanshin Tigers is that the Central League is the starting line for my professional life. I aim to win the championship so that my fans will continue to support me. I will do my best. "
